Material Characteristics to Consider when Pelletizing Limestone

Pelletizing limestone creates a product with a multitude of benefits. Consequently, pelletized limestone is becoming increasingly popular for residential, agricultural, and commercial users. However, there are a number of material characteristics to contend with before a quality limestone pellet is produced. The following article highlights three challenging material characteristics associated with pelletizing limestone, as well as the benefits that occur when limestone is processed into a pelletized form.

Limestone’s Material Characteristics

The following material characteristics are key influences in the limestone pelletizing process:

1. Particle Size Distribution

Limestone is crushed into a very fine powder prior to use in end products such as cement or soil amendments. However, this powdered form is difficult to handle unless mixed or formed into another state. This holds especially true for soil applications, because powdered limestone can blow erratically around a field, making it difficult to know the application rate, or where the material will eventually end up, not to mention it results in product waste. This can also be a nuisance to neighboring areas that don’t need limestone applications.

2. Abrasive

Mined limestone is abrasive as a raw material. As a result, robust equipment is needed in order to prepare the rock for various manufacturing purposes. For example, a rotary dryer is a preferred choice in instances where a drying step is used. Rotary dryers are customizable to withstand abrasive applications and handle the rigors of high-volume materials while reducing the overall moisture content within the limestone rock.

3. Varying Composition

Limestone can vary considerably in texture, porosity, and composition. For this reason, testing is recommended to define the best processing methods.

Characteristics of Pelletized Limestone

Pelletized Limestone is gaining popularity due to the following beneficial product characteristics found in pelletized limestone soil amendments:

Reduced Dusting

By processing the material into a pellet form, pelletized limestone is easier to store, handle, and properly apply in soil-related applications.

Uniformity

Pelletized limestone is more consistent in composition and shape, improving application rates and providing the right amount of nutrients where they are needed. It is evenly applied via mechanical spreading machines and also resists clumping in its pelletized form.

Nutrient Delivery

Crushed limestone has a coarse grit that sometimes takes several months to break down. In comparison, limestone pellets quickly break down when exposed to rain or moisture, making nutrients immediately available to the targeted plants and the most reliable choice in terms of nutrient delivery. When applied to soil, limestone neutralizes soil pH and adds calcium and magnesium carbonates.
